Abstract :
Visual interpretation of SAR images plays a critical role in remote sensing applications. For rapidly obtaining the image suitable for human observation, a new method of visualization for SAR images is proposed in this paper. The statistics of the SAR data, including the single channel data intensity and the span of the Pol-SAR data, are derived. The proposed method is a parameterized method based on the characteristic statistic of the SAR data. Using the AIRSAR data, the effectiveness of the proposed method is demonstrated by comparing to the traditional algorithm.
